Front Seat Heater/cooler problems of the 1998 Chrysler Town & Country

Two problems related to front seat heater/cooler have been reported for the 1998 Chrysler Town & Country. The most recently reported issues are listed below.

1 Front Seat Heater/cooler problem

Failure Date: 01/18/2002

Driver side seat heater shorted and caught the driver's seat on fire. Our children were in the van. Fortunately my wife was present, standing outside the van and used snow to put out the fire. Not just a smolder. . . A very real fire with flame and smoke. The dealer told us he was checking on the situation and Chrysler would call us. No-one ever called. The dealer finally, after 3 months told us no-one was going to even check into the problem he told us to let the vehicle burn up next time. We called the manufacturer. They also said they would not do anything at all and not to call again. All we want is a new seat that is not a hazard to catching my van on fire. We were lucky this time. What if my children were injured or killed? what if the van catches fire in my garage? we need help. Nlm.
